  Dongzhou, an important town in the north of the Yangtze River, is more than 300 kilometers away from Nanjiang, the provincial capital. Now the Huaxia High-speed Railway extends in all directions, and it can be reached in more than an hour by high-speed rail.

This is the first time for Xu Chunliang to travel alone. With his current position, he can only sit in the second-class seat. He booked a window-facing seat on the official website in advance. The carriage is not quiet, with laughter, conversation, and children crying. The sound and the external sound of the mobile phone are intertwined, which is very noisy. Anyway, the journey is not too long. Such an environment is also a kind of cultivation for the state of mind.

  Xu Chunliang put on his earphones and listened to the music. Not long after the train started, his grandfather called and asked him if he was on the train?

  Xu Changshan said that it was time to let his grandson go out and make a fortune, but he still couldn't let go in the bottom of his heart.

  Xu Chunliang told him that everything was going well, and the old man told him not to forget to practice acupuncture during this time. He was more proficient in his work than industrious. To reassure him, Xu Chunliang specially brought a needle box and passed the security check.

  Xu Chunliang chatted with the old man for a few words before hanging up the phone.

Just as she hung up the phone, Cheng Xiaohong called in. She made this call just to complain. Xu Chunliang patted his **** and went to Nanjiang for recuperation. .

  There are no tigers and monkeys in the mountains to call themselves kings. Huang Lide regards himself as the director of the department and shouts at her.

  Xu Chunliang expressed deep sympathy for Cheng Xiaohong's current situation, but there was nothing he could do to help her. He could only comfort Cheng Xiaohong to bear with it, and he would come back in a week, and then he could help her share the work pressure again.

  Cheng Xiaohong complained that she might have schizophrenia in less than a week, and finally reminded Xu Chunliang to help her bring a Shuiximen salted duck when she came back. Her partner loves it very much.

  Xu Chunliang agreed straight away, and he was happy to do the thing of giving roses with lingering fragrance in his hands. Cheng Xiaohong is a love brain, and she is quite concerned about her current boyfriend.

  I thought I could end the call with Cheng Xiaohong, but Cheng Xiaohong still didn't want to put down the phone, and told him one thing. This morning, Tang Mingmei, the head nurse of the Department of Neurology, came to see him specially.

  Xu Chunliang reckoned that nine times out of ten he still had to introduce his partner. This Tang Mingmei was also an enthusiastic person, and he told Cheng Xiaohong to keep an eye on Huang Lide and Yang Zhengang's movements while he was away from work.

Cheng Xiaohong understood what he meant, and realized that Xu Chunliang went to the training this time to make a lot of sense. With his character, he should not give up lightly. He probably will make some moves after he comes back. Monitor their every move.

The announcement in the carriage suddenly sounded: "Urgent help, please pay attention to passengers, a passenger in the No. 1 car of this train has a sudden emergency and has fallen into a coma. If there are medical staff among the passengers, please come to the No. 1 car for help." Rescue, the situation is urgent, please come to compartment 1 to participate in the rescue, thank you for your support!"

  Xu Chunliang first looked around. The noise in the car was as usual. Most of the passengers were listening, but no one got up. Maybe there were no medical workers among them, or they might have the mentality that more things are worse than less things.

The radio call for help is still repeating. It seems that the situation is very urgent. There are 45 minutes before the next station. There are medical resources.

  At this time, the flight attendant trotted all the way into the compartment he was in: "Is there a doctor?" It seemed that the situation was indeed urgent. Not only did the broadcast call for help, but all the flight attendants were mobilized.

  Xu Chunliang stood up: "I'll go take a look with you."

  The flight attendant glanced at him. Although she didn't like to judge people by their appearance, the doctor in front of her was too young. Young means inexperienced. Now the patient is in an emergency. Can he handle it?

  But no one stood up except Xu Chunliang in the compartment, and the steward nodded quickly after a brief hesitation: "Please follow me!"

Xu Chunliang followed her to the No. 1 car. The No. 1 car was a business class. Before him, there was a doctor. He was Li Jiakuan, the director of the Anorectal Department of Gusui Hospital of Traditional Chinese Medicine. The middle part of the top of the head is completely bald, leaving a long strand of hair on the left side to cover the barren land on the top of the head. Although the hair is sparse, it is neatly combed, which fully reflects the rigorous life of a medical worker manner.

  When Xu Chunliang arrived, Li Jiakuan was kneeling there doing cardiopulmonary resuscitation for the patient. The patient was lying reclined in the aisle, in his fifties, and the T-shirt on his upper body had been taken off for the convenience of rescue.

  Beside him stood a glamorous girl in black. I don't know whether it was because of her nervousness or the contrast of the black clothes. Her delicate face was dazzlingly white but bloodless.

  The conductors and police officers are maintaining order at the scene. In order to facilitate the rescue, they temporarily invited the passengers in the business class to sit in the dining car.

   While performing CPR, Li Jiakuan asked the flight attendant nervously, is there an automatic external defibrillator in the car? The flight attendant shook his head. Now every high-speed rail station is basically equipped with an automatic external defibrillator, but not every train is equipped with it. After all, such unexpected situations rarely happen.

  After Li Jiakuan arrived, he found that the man's carotid artery had no pulse and his breathing stopped. He judged that the patient had suffered a cardiac arrest. Without hesitation, with the help of everyone, he immediately laid the patient down, knelt on the ground, and started chest compressions.

Before Xu Chunliang arrived, he had been pressing continuously for ten minutes, his forehead was covered with sweat, and the strand of hair used to cover his bald spot also fell down due to gravity, covering half of his face, and swayed with his pressing movements It looks quite funny, but no one at the scene wants to laugh, and no one can laugh in the face of life and death.

Xu Chunliang came to the patient and put his hand on his pulse gate, but he could not feel his pulse beating. Looking at the patient's nails, the color was blue and purple, and the lips were black. It was obviously a symptom of blood stasis blocking the heart veins, and the condition had already passed. Extremely serious, the way to cure it is to promote blood circulation and remove blood stasis, regulate qi and dredge collaterals.

  But the patient has no heartbeat at present, the most urgent thing is to make his heart beat again, otherwise this person will undoubtedly die.

Li Jiakuan took a look at Xu Chunliang. From his actions, he could tell that this new young man was also a Chinese medicine doctor. He could not help but secretly complain. It is an indisputable fact that Chinese medicine is inferior to Western medicine in terms of first aid. What is most needed at this time is a doctor. Cardiologists, not Chinese medicine practitioners like myself, can do nothing but CPR.

  Li Jiakuan didn't dare to relax the movements of his hands in the slightest: "Can you do CPR?" Manual cardiopulmonary resuscitation is a physical job, and he needs someone to take turns.

  Xu Chunliang shook his head, he didn't know what CPR was.

  Li Jiakuan stared at him: "Then what are you doing here?" He was already quite tired, but the doctor's original intention of curing diseases and saving lives made him clenched his teeth and persisted.

  Xu Chunliang was not angry because of his attitude, and took out the ebony needle box from his backpack. Li Jiakuan looked stunned. Is this kid going to give acupuncture to the patient? Although he is also a doctor of traditional Chinese medicine, he does not think that acupuncture can play any role in this situation. Artificial cardiopulmonary resuscitation is the only feasible method at present.

  With the passage of time, the patient's symptoms did not improve, and Li Jiakuan's confidence also faded a little bit. Apart from the two Chinese medicine practitioners, are there no other doctors on this train?

   "Don't mess around!"

A voice sounded from behind, and another doctor arrived after hearing the news. This is a well-known expert in the province, Xu Donglai, director of the Endocrinology Department of Nanjiang Drum Tower Hospital. After identifying himself, he conducted a physical examination for the patient. The patient's condition was very poor. The high-speed train was still thirty-seven minutes away from the terminal station Nanjiang, which ruled out the possibility of stopping halfway and being sent to the hospital for emergency treatment.

The only way left was artificial cardiopulmonary resuscitation. Xu Donglai took over Li Jiakuan's chest compressions and asked Li Jiakuan to be in charge of artificial respiration. All they are doing now is doing their best to obey the destiny, hoping that their efforts will produce miracles.

  The steward who brought Xu Chunliang here also saw that the young man didn't seem to be able to help, so he patted him and pointed outside, meaning that if you can't help, don't make trouble here.

Xu Chunliang unhurriedly opened the needle box, sighed and said, "You guys can't save him like this. If the heart still can't beat within five minutes, the meridians around his body will be completely stagnant, and he will be regarded as a **** at that time." It can't be saved either."

  Xu Donglai said angrily: "What do you know? Train conductor, please get out the irrelevant people, and don't interfere with our rescue." It is too arrogant for young people to point fingers at them at this time.

  The flight attendant next to Xu Chunliang tugged at his sleeve, she was really embarrassed, this person was invited by her.

  Xu Chunliang had no intention of leaving at all: "Rescue is not about treating a dead horse as a living horse doctor."

  He said to the glamorous girl in black, "Why don't you let me try?" From the moment he arrived, he could tell that this woman was the patient's companion and the person who could decide the patient's life and death.

  The girl in black looked at him curiously. Even though the people around her were in such a dangerous situation, her expression was as peaceful as the autumn moon in the lake.

  Xu Chunliang took out the needle without waiting for her reply, and removed the patient's socks. He had no intention of interfering with the treatment of the other two doctors, but the situation was very critical. If he didn't act again, it would be too late.
